Alternating between 'scripts' for memorizing astrological information about the Zodiac and interviews with memory-arts practitioners, the Astrologer's Palace provides high-quality opportunities to practice memory arts using the basic dichotomy in use since ancient times: memory of place, and memory of image.

Taurus is the first of the nocturnal signs: fixed, earthy, cold, dry and melancholy. It’s comfortable (some might say lazy), and everything is bolted down (because once Venus makes up her mind, it stays where she’s put it). Enjoy this week’s walk through a sign of the Zodiac.
